EXCEEDS logo
Exceeds
Hank Zhan

PROFILE

Hank Zhan

Developed enhancements for CBT volume management in the vmware/govmomi repository, focusing on improving Change Block Tracking (CBT) reliability within container-native storage workflows. Introduced new APIs in Go to set and clear CBT control flags in the CNS, enabling more precise management of data-change tracking for backup and restore operations. Updated the verification logic for CBT status in volume queries, reducing inconsistencies and strengthening integration with cloud services. Emphasized robust API development and comprehensive unit testing to ensure reliability. The work addressed critical needs in backup workflows, contributing to more dependable volume management and streamlined storage operations in cloud environments.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
1
Lines of code
417
Activity Months1

Work History

April 2026

2 Commits • 1 Features

Apr 1, 2026

April 2026: Delivered CBT Volume Management Enhancements for vmware/govmomi, introducing CNS CBT control APIs and improved verification for CBT status in volume queries. These changes increase reliability of Change Block Tracking and strengthen backup/restore workflows and container-native storage integrations. Notable commits include 774caabe3d344c220fb490eb488342c1cb4d55bb and 61e1166f865daf605e5577a54bd0ecc58c26c44a.

Activity

Loading activity data...

Quality Metrics

Correctness80.0%
Maintainability80.0%
Architecture80.0%
Performance80.0%
AI Usage30.0%

Skills & Technologies

Programming Languages

Go

Technical Skills

API DevelopmentCloud ServicesGoGo programmingTestingtestingunit testing

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

vmware/govmomi

Apr 2026 Apr 2026
1 Month active

Languages Used

Go

Technical Skills

API DevelopmentCloud ServicesGoGo programmingTestingtesting